Work with Finance to ensure the full cost control of project(s) including providing and monitoring budgets and forecasts
Ensure that all contemporary records are kept and filed by the project team members for use in supporting claims, extensions of time, and the evaluation of variations.
Assist in the delivery of commercial best practice with risk, change, cost, and value management.
Assist in the collation of data/facts with respect of all variations (changes) to the works in conjunction with other project team members.
Work within time periods required under the Contract(s) and as required by the Company.
In conjunction with the commercial and operational teams, assisting in the delivery of all commercial activities on the project including CVR reporting, and WIP management in line with contractual entitlement.
Support the Commercial and Procurement teams in all aspects of subcontract procurement and payment in accordance with governance and fair payment processes.
Adhere to all company polices and to the Amey systems, processes, and procedures on Contracts of varying sizes.
Administer a robust coding structure to facilitate accurate cost capture. Producing monthly and/or weekly cost and value data to assist the Commercial team in submitting timely applications for payment, Change requests and any additional contractual requirements.
Assist in the identification, mitigation and management of opportunity and risk.

Headquartered in London, delivers full lifecycle solutions across roads, rail, facilities, and utilities.
Blends data-driven consulting with large-scale delivery, advising on analytics, asset condition, and digital platforms.
Typical projects include major highway improvements, railway electrification, signalling renewals, complex facilities upkeep, and public-sector estate upgrades.
Consulting arm advises on strategic asset management for clients like Network Rail and MTA’s Long Island Rail Road, with operations in North America and Australia.
A standout example is a Birmingham highways turnaround, demonstrating ability to navigate challenges for resilient, long-term infrastructure outcomes.
From restoring historic bridges to optimizing EV charging networks in Manchester via bespoke data models, brings creativity and engineering rigour to projects.

Achieves an 80% reduction in Scope 1 and 2 emissions by 2035, with full Scope 3 neutrality by 2040.
52.8% Cut
Scope 1 & 2 Reduction
Reduces Scope 1 and 2 emissions by 52.8% by 2030, validated by the Science Based Targets Initiative (SBTi).

Carbon footprint (2019–2021) verified to ISO 14064‑1 by BSI
PAS 2080 applied on all projects >£1 m; accredited to PAS 2060 carbon neutrality and ISO 14001
Four sustainability pillars: decarbonisation, nature‑positive work, infrastructure resilience, internal emissions control
Launched AI/data‑driven Net Zero mapping service in built environment, integrating biodiversity and energy efficiency
